草庐IT

textView

全部标签

android - 从文本文件中读取数据并将其显示在 TextView 上

我正在尝试从我的原始文件夹中的文本文件“temp.txt”中读取数据,并在单击“按钮”按钮时在TextView“文本”上显示文件的内容,但我的应用程序崩溃了在这样做的同时,我很可能以错误的方式进行操作,因为我是android和java编程的新手。我在这里粘贴代码,任何帮助将不胜感激案例编号:InputStreamis=getResources().openRawResource(R.raw.temp);BufferedReaderbr=newBufferedReader(newInputStreamReader(is));try{string=br.readLine();while(s

android - 使用 getCurrentTextColor() 设置文本颜色

我需要从TextView获取当前文本颜色,然后将此值分配给TextView.setTextColor()。但是我得到一个很大的int-1979711488138,我怎样才能从中得到颜色? 最佳答案 IntegerintColor=-1979711488138;StringhexColor="#"+Integer.toHexString(intColor).substring(2);或StringhexColor=String.format("#%06X",(0xFFFFFF&intColor));

android - 从新 Activity 布局中删除默认 TextView

当您使用IDE构造函数(new->activity)创建新Activity时-在AndroidStudio和Eclipse中-它会创建新的java文件、布局文件、添加Activitylist等每次在布局文件中出现带有“HelloWorld”文本的TextView(如果您选择“BlankActivity”模式)。字符串值“HelloWorld”也会自动添加到字符串res文件中。当然,手动删除字符串值和TextView不需要特别的努力,但有一天它会变得非常烦人。我的问题:是否有办法改变新的Activity创建机制并只创建空的Activity布局文件(仅限容器布局,例如RelativeLay

java - 在平板电脑上滚动列表后意外重用了选定的列表项背景颜色

对于我在平板电脑上的ListView,我试图让我选择的列表项选择在选择时保持其状态,但不幸的是我看到了一些奇怪的行为。出于某种原因,每当我将列表滚动到所选项目不可见的位置,然后滚动回到所选项目可见的位置时,背景颜色意外地被重新使用。我相信getView方法中需要包含某些内容,但我不确定如何使用此方法。为了防止背景色被重复使用,必须做什么?适配器类publicclassVictoriaListAdapterextendsBaseAdapter{privateListmData;privateLayoutInflatermInflater;publicVictoriaListAdapter

android - 如何在textview的不同单词上设置多个点击监听器?

Facebook应用程序是如何做到的。一个textView中的多个可点击文本。我尝试了FlowLayout和多个texview,但当文本超过宽度时,texview仍然转移到另一行。 最佳答案 SpannableString在Android中用于在SingleTextView中通过不同的点击事件突出显示文本的特定部分。你可以查看#SODemoforthisHowtosetthepartofthetextviewisclickableAndroid:ClickableSpaninclickableTextView希望对您有所帮助。

java - Picasso 图像加载后,Horizo​​ntalGridView/RecyclerView 滚动位置会重置

我有一个Horizo​​ntalGridView并且一切正常,但是我正在使用Picasso加载图像,每当加载图像时,Horizo​​ntalGridView都会快速回到第一个项目/开始滚动位置。我在Activity上也有一个mapfragment,并注意到当与map交互时,Horizo​​ntalGridView显示相同的行为。下面是适配器代码。请帮助,现在已经坚持了几天......publicclassGridElementAdapterextendsRecyclerView.Adapter{privateContextcontext;privateDeal[]mDeals;publ

android - 使用 <include> 标签时如何将 TextView 添加到工具栏?

所以,我有一个toolbar.xml文件:而且,我有一个我布局中的标记:所以我听说如果我想把Activity的标题放在toolbar上居中,我只需要添加一个TextVIew到工具栏,像这样:但是,我使用的是include标签,文本显然没有显示:那么,我该怎么做才能解决这个问题呢?这是它的显示方式:如果你想看我完整的真实布局,去here.这是我的Activity,如果它有帮助的话:http://pastebin.com/g6ZXAxe5 最佳答案 如果您想将View添加到您的Toolbar中,则必须将其添加到Toolbar中作为sub

android - TextView 在 ViewPager 中滚动时拦截触摸事件

在ViewPager中有一个TextView,当ViewPager从靠近TextView的部分开始滚动时事件被TextView本身拦截。这个TextView在ViewPager中fragment的相对布局android:id="@+id/tv_course_name"android:layout_width="match_parent"android:layout_height="wrap_content"android:text="ExampleCourse"android:singleline="true"android:ellipsize="marquee"android:mar

安卓输入法 : showing a custom pop-up dialog (like Swype keyboard) which can enter text into the TextView

我想知道如何创建自定义弹出窗口,如下面的屏幕截图(借自Swype键盘),我可以在其中有几个按钮,每个按钮向当前“已连接”提交一个字符串"TextView(通过InputConnection)。请注意:这是一个InputMethodService而不是普通的Activity。我已经尝试使用Theme:Dialog启动一个单独的Activity。但是,一旦那个打开,我就失去了对TextView的关注,我的键盘也消失了(随之而来的是我的InputConnection消失了)。 最佳答案 您可以尝试使用PopupWindow.您必须进行一些

android - 如何将弹跳动画应用于我的 TextView ?

我想对我的文本应用弹跳动画。有可能这样做吗?如果是这样,你能告诉我怎么做吗?谢谢。 最佳答案 更新链接[谢谢kaay用于指示所有以前的链接现在都是404]有一个BouncingBallexample在Android源代码中,这可以作为您的起点。另一个很好的资源是BouncingaballonAndroid’scanvasAndroidAnimationTutorial 关于android-如何将弹跳动画应用于我的TextView?,我们在StackOverflow上找到一个类似的问题: